| QuickBooks Customer Contact List | | - We need Customer in the file before we can read it.
- This export does not include the amount each customer still owes you, so nothing of that kind comes across.
- 1 column stays behind because the same address arrives split across the street, city, state, ZIP and country columns: Billing Address.
- 6 columns stay behind because we keep one address for a company: Shipping Address, Shipping Street, Shipping State, Shipping City, Shipping Country and Shipping ZIP.
- 1 column stays behind because we keep when a record was last changed here, not when it was changed in your old system: Last Modified.
- 1 column stays behind because we keep when a record arrived here, not when it was typed into your old system: Create Date.
- 1 column stays behind because the people who worked in your old system are not people here: Last Modified By.
- 2 columns stay behind because we never bring card numbers across: Credit Card # and CC Expires.
- 2 columns stay behind because the full name column already carries the person we create for this customer: Last Name and First Name.
- 8 columns have no home here yet, so we keep the values as extra columns on the record: Delivery Method, Other, Tax Rate, Taxable, Resale #, Terms, Payment Method and Currency.
- Photos and files come over on their own.

| Xero contacts | | - We need ContactName in the file before we can read it.
- This export does not include invoices, payments and credits, so nothing of that kind comes across.
- 5 columns stay behind because we keep one address for a person: SAAddressLine1, SACity, SARegion, SAZipCode and SACountry.
- 7 columns have no home here yet, so we keep the values as extra columns on the record: AccountNumber, POAttentionTo, POAddressLine2, FaxNumber, SkypeName, TaxNumber and LegalName.
- We wrote down what this download looks like from the published guides rather than from a file we have seen, so a column we do not recognise is possible.
- Photos and files come over on their own.

| Xero invoices | | - We need ContactName, InvoiceNumber, InvoiceDate, DueDate, Description, Quantity, UnitAmount, AccountCode and TaxType in the file before we can read it.
- This export does not include payments, credits and refunds, so nothing of that kind comes across.
- We do not bring bills and the rest of the money you owe across yet.
- 1 column has no home here yet, so we keep the values as extra columns on the record: Reference.
- Photos and files come over on their own.
